Differential efficacy of a synthetic antagonist of VLA-4 during the course of chronic relapsing experimental autoimmune encephalomyelitis
Abstract
The integrin VLA-4 has been shown to play a key role in the entry of antigen-specific T cells into the CNS during autoimmune demyelination. Treatment of animals with experimental autoimmune encephalomyelitis (EAE), a model of multiple sclerosis, with antibodies to VLA-4 is known to suppress acute disease.
